📖 Name Origin & Meaning

Origin: English
Pronunciation: RIET
Gender: Primarily Male

Meaning:

From an occupational surname meaning "craftsman", ultimately from Old English wyrhta. Famous bearers of the surname were the Wright brothers (Wilbur 1867-1912 and Orville 1871-1948), the inventors of the first successful airplane, and Frank Lloyd Wright (1867-1959), an American architect.
